Key Facts
- The Killer Instinct's instance of is recorded as album[3].
- The Killer Instinct's genre is hard rock[4].
- The Killer Instinct followed All Hell Breaks Loose[5].
- The Killer Instinct was followed by Heavy Fire[6].
- The Killer Instinct was produced by Nick Raskulinecz[7].
- The Killer Instinct was performed by Black Star Riders[8].
- The Killer Instinct's record label is recorded as Nuclear Blast[9].
- The Killer Instinct's language of work or name is recorded as English[10].
- The Killer Instinct was published on 2015[11].
